370z 19'' wheels Install
Hey folks, i'll be picking up a set of 370z wheels for my 04 sedan which is currently dropped on H&R springs. So my question is, given the ride height what will be the best setup to prevent rubbing and tire wear? I know that i'll def have to Roll my fenders but as far as Camber kit, spacers and tire size im kinda clueless Any input will be appreciated, Will post pics after installed

The 19" wheels have the same offset & width of the s tune nismo 19" I just put on my car.
255/35/19 front and 265/35/19 rear.
Front 20mm spacer probably move up to a 25 and rear no spacer at all.
-2.0 camber set front & rear, NO rubbing except the front rubs on that small notch in the fender liner where the bracket sits behind for the bumper. Need to relocate and that will solve problem.
